The number of ad blocks definitely affect your CPC, because putting too many of them on a page increases the chances of displaying the 'cheaper' ads on the page and being clicked on. It also decreases your eCPM because of the higher number of ad impressions. The location of your ad blocks may also affect your CPC, since it determines which becomes more visible to your reader's eye - the expensive or the cheaper ads.
